Problem: Users need clear visibility and control over their AI usage costs. Without transparent credit systems, users may experience bill shock or avoid using AI features due to uncertainty about costs.

Example: A user wants to try an AI writing assistant but is hesitant because they don't know how much each request will cost or when they'll run out of credits.

Usage: Essential for any pay-per-use AI service, especially those with variable costs based on input length, complexity, or processing time.


Solution

Credit-based monetization provides users with clear, predictable pricing while giving them control over their spending. Key components include:

Transparent Credit Display

  • Prominent Balance: Show current credit balance in a easily visible location
  • Cost Per Action: Display the cost of each AI operation before execution
  • Usage History: Provide detailed logs of credit consumption over time
  • Remaining Estimates: Show approximately how many operations are possible with remaining credits

Flexible Credit Management

  • Multiple Purchase Options: Offer various credit packages to suit different usage patterns
  • Auto-Recharge: Allow users to set up automatic credit purchases when balance gets low
  • Bulk Discounts: Provide better rates for larger credit purchases
  • Rollover Policies: Clear communication about credit expiration and rollover rules

User-Friendly Interfaces

  • Pre-Purchase Estimates: Show estimated cost before starting expensive operations
  • Low Balance Warnings: Alert users when credits are running low
  • Easy Top-Up: Streamlined process for purchasing additional credits
  • Usage Analytics: Help users understand their consumption patterns

Rationale

Credit-based monetization systems offer several advantages for both users and providers:

For Users

  • Predictable Costs: Know exactly what each operation will cost
  • Budget Control: Set spending limits and avoid unexpected charges
  • Value Transparency: Clear connection between what you pay and what you get
  • Flexible Usage: Pay only for what you use without monthly commitments

For Providers

  • Revenue Predictability: Users pre-pay for services
  • Reduced Churn: Clear pricing reduces billing disputes
  • Upsell Opportunities: Easy to encourage larger credit purchases
  • Cost Alignment: Pricing can reflect actual computational costs

Implementation Guidelines

  1. Start Simple: Begin with straightforward per-operation pricing
  2. Show Value: Clearly communicate the benefits users receive for each credit spent
  3. Provide Options: Offer both small and large credit packages
  4. Enable Tracking: Give users detailed visibility into their usage patterns
  5. Communicate Clearly: Ensure all pricing and policies are transparent and easy to understand
